Opals Rout Philippines in Asia Cup Opener
The Australian Opals began their FIBA Women's Asia Cup 2025 campaign with a commanding 115-39 win over the Philippines in Shenzhen, China, highlighted by Miela Sowah's 19 points and Chloe Bibby's double-double, with all 11 players scoring and six finishing in double digits. The team, coached by Paul Goriss in Sandy Brondello's absence, tallied 36 assists and forced 22 turnovers, demonstrating depth and cohesion. This opening victory puts Australia atop Group B alongside Japan, as they pursue their first Asia Cup title after earning both silver and bronze medals since joining the Asian region in 2017. The squad features a blend of experienced veterans and promising debutants, with upcoming group matches against Lebanon and Japan. Host nation China leads Group A as the defending champions. Winning the tournament would secure the Opals' direct qualification to the 2026 FIBA Women's World Cup in Germany.
